Part 5: Method 3 – The "No Computer / Enterprise Cert" Method (Risky)
If you search YouTube for "how to install ams1gn on ios patched," you will see spammy videos suggesting you go to randomappstore . com and click "Install." These use Enterprise Certificates.
How it works: Apple gives companies certificates to test apps internally. Hackers steal these certificates and sign IPAs with them.
The problem: Apple patches (revokes) these certificates every few days to weeks. Part 5: Method 3 – The "No Computer

Error 2: "Maximum number of apps (3) signed"
- Cause: Free Apple IDs can only have 3 active sideloaded apps.
- Fix: Delete an old sideloaded app via AltStore or Sideloadly, then try again.
